As President of the Frederick City Council and former President Pro Tem of the Board of Aldermen, Katie Nash has demonstrated a commitment to responsive leadership and effective governance. Her accomplishments include:​
Leadership
In December 2024, Katie was elected as the inaugural President of the newly established City Council, transitioning from the previous Board of Aldermen structure. This role underscores her colleagues' confidence in her leadership abilities. ​

Advocacy for Responsible Growth
Our City is our Home. We want our home to be a great place to live, work and play - inviting, inclusive, dynamic - awesome! We also want to ensure that we continue to advocate for responsible growth. This sometimes means making tough, but responsible decisions, which Katie has made since serving on the city council. Katie proposed targeted development moratoria for designated sections of the City requiring rezoning to help ensure that development aligns first with our community's capacity and infrastructure. ​We need to get it right the first time.
